			<abstract label="Abstract:" encodinganalog="520$a">The Texas House of Representatives
				Committee to Investigate the Retrieve Prison Farm was formed in 1935 to investigate
				charges of brutality resulting in prisoner self-mutilation at the Retrieve Prison
				Farm in Brazoria County. Records of the committee consist of a six-page typescript
				report submitted by the committee to the House. The report is dated May 6, 1935 and
				has the original signatures of the committee members.</abstract>

			<head>Agency History</head>
			<p>The Texas House of Representatives Committee to Investigate the Retrieve Prison Farm
				was formed (House Simple Resolution 121, 44th Texas Legislature, Regular Session,
				1935) to investigate charges of brutality at the Retrieve Prison Farm. Allegedly,
				inmates at this prison farm had been subjected to such brutal treatment that they
				had mutilated themselves in order to escape further punishment.</p>
			<p>The committee visited the Brazoria County farm and heard testimony from convicts,
				guards, and prison officials. In their report to the House, the committee found that
				over twenty convicts had maimed themselves in separate incidents in the previous
				year but that no single cause could be blamed. The committee did identify such
				factors as a desire to avoid work in the fields, agitation by other convicts, and
				mistreatment by some of the guards as reasons for the self-mutilation. The committee
				ended their report by recommending that convicts be segregated by the seriousness of
				their crimes and urged a more humanitarian approach in the overall treament of
				prison inmates. The Retrieve Prison Farm later became the Wayne Scott Unit within
				the Correctional Institutions Division of the Texas Department of Criminal
				Justice.</p>
